Daily Report for Thu, Jun 19, 2008
Markets Re-cap
Bad earnings reports from Morgan Stanley (MS) and FedEx (FDX) hammered the DJIA (-131.24 -1.08% to 12029.06), S&P 500 (-13.12 -0.97% to 1337.81) and NASDAQ Composite (-28.02 -1.14% to 2429.7) for a second day in a row.
The Toronto Composite moved slightly ahead (+4.30 +0.03% to 15073.13), while the Toronto Venture Exchange index fell (-9.23 -0.35% to 2628.8). One look at the Money Flow of the TSE chart shows that for six or seven weeks, there has been a massive selling process underway as the index moved higher on increasingly fewer leaders, like Research in Motion (RIM). In fact, the Daily chart of the Venture Exchange (CDNX) shows more clearly the reality of the selling process. In other words, I think the Toronto market is held by a string that can’t withstand many more days like the massive international selling that went on yesterday and early today in Asia-Pacific markets.
Earlier today, Australia (-1.19%), Shanghai (-6.54%), Hong Kong (-2.26%), India (-2.17%) and Japan (-2.23%) all followed the sell-off that occurred yesterday in the US.
Yesterday, in the US equity market, the top performing sector ETF was Energy (XLE +0.38%), while the worst were Consumer Discretionary (XLY -2.20%) and Financials (XLF -21.66%).
Among industry groups, the best were Oil Services ($OSX +0.90%) and Goldminers ($XAU +0.68%), while the worst were Banks ($BKX -2.90%), Semi-conductors ($SOX -2.32%) and Retailers ($RLX -1.91%).
For the Cara 100, the best performer was SYT (+1.55%), while the worst were consumer stocks (BC -6.0%, JCP -5.0% and WFMI -3.9%).
The earnings of brokerage giant Morgan Stanley plunged -60% for the Q2, to $1.03 billion ($0.95 a share), down from $2.58 billion a year earlier. Traders had been alerted to the problems on Wall Street that are much more serious than just “sub-prime” related.
With all-time record high fuel costs, FedEx reported losing -$241 million (-$0.78 cents a share) versus earnings of $610 million a year earlier.
Crude Oil ($WTIC) turned higher in the mid-afternoon, closing at $1.3717/barrel (+$2.64/bbl) when the $USD sank on concerns over a potential workers strike in Nigeria. The US Dept of Energy also reported crude oil inventories declined -1.2 million bbls last week and gasoline inventories fell by the same amount although the consensus had been for an increase of +800,000 barrels, which also pushed up the oil price.
The US Dollar weakened a bit at 73.43 (-0.11%), while the Euro strengthened a bit (+0.13%) to 1.5533.
The long-dated US Bond ($USB) gained +0.68% on the day as yields came off. The T-Bill yield dropped from 1.955 to 1.880 yesterday as capital flowed from equities into cash.
The $GOLD futures closed up +$6.60/oz to 893.50, but are a little softer this morning as the $USD strengthened.
With a slightly positive $USD this morning, the precious metal spot prices are down a small bit: 890.95, 464, 2054 and 17.26 for gold, palladium, platinum and silver, respectively.
Crude oil futures are trading down -0.955 to 135.725/bbl at this point in the morning, and the DJIA futures are up +32 to 12060.
European bourse prices are flat so far today.
Everybody seems to be waiting to see if the selling wave of the past couple days is over.

I had to drop Trane (TT) from the Cara 100 as it was acquired by another company. In its place, I added McDonalds (MCD) largely for the reasons I discussed in the WIR of June-08.
McDonalds [GICS 30, Dow 30]
(MCD: Value Line Report Jun. 6: next one is due Sept. 5)With regard to McDonalds, the Value Line analyst seems to be enamoured with the ramp up in earnings this year as he has forecasted growth from $2.91/share to $3.40/share, which is a +17% growth, more than double the normal growth range for this company.
Still, he says, "the shares offer below-average capital appreciation potential 3 to 5 years hence." The good news is that MCD is "a good pick for value-conscious investors" he says.
I can't argue either way. What I do feel is that the metrics are good enough now for inclusion of the company in the Cara 100, and I have been giving some thought to that.
As you know, there is a difference between a company and its share price. This company is well managed. But the stock has had a big run from $12 in 1Q03 to its present $56.95. I don't think we'll see that kind of performance again for a while.
Remember; the Cara 100 Global list is a watchlist of over-performing companies with (for the most part) sound financials. The Cara 100 is not a list of stocks that I recommend. Timing of trades is a whole different matter. But, if you stick with quality, quality, quality, then you get to focus on a few companies whose stocks always seem to outperform the broad market in terms of total returns (dividends as well as capital gains) when market conditions are right. Our job, then, is made easier in that we review a relatively small selection of higher quality situations, leaving us more time for risk management processes.
